I think he is saying that once you have a farm, it doesn't matter whether you have bonemeal or not - so why change it? What makes it overpowered? Am I right, Mumbles?
He does not understand that you should get very low yield from "farming" if you don't actually "make a farm". There was no reason to make a full-size farm before, you didn't really "need" to do it. Carry seeds and bones with you and you can always just till the dirt and make enough wheat to feed yourself. In the field, and at very low cost, and almost instantaneously. This was overpowered functionality.
For some reason I think he is looking at it like the only purpose bonemeal served was for getting a farm started and that now it is harder and you essentially miss the "window of opportunity" for it to be useful. That's blatantly inaccurate and I can guarantee that bonemeal will still be used.
Mumbles, do you realize this is for balancing because of the dispenser's new ability to use the bonemeal?
